Amy Welde

Amy Welde is an experienced editor and proofreader with a diverse background in editing various types of client documents, including marketing communications, technical documents, and academic works. Currently serving as an editor at Dragonfly Editorial since June 2018, Amy also operates as a self-employed editor and proofreader. Previous roles include editing and proofreading for Temple University and providing writing support at the University of Maryland Global Campus. Amy's career began in compensation analysis, holding positions at AmerisourceBergen, UHS, and Hay Group, where responsibilities included conducting compensation analysis and training. Amy holds a Master of Science in Industrial and Organizational Psychology from Clemson University, along with multiple bachelor's degrees in Psychology and Communication Disorders, and a professional certificate in Editing from UC Berkeley Extension.
